This paper reviews efforts by various organizations to develop principles and procedures for the safety evaluation of flavouring substances. Critical factors considered in safety evaluation of these substances include their level of human intake, ease of metabolism to innocuous end-products and the margin of safety between no-observed-effect levels in animal studies and human intakes. These factors form the basis for the principles and criteria laid out in this paper.  相似文献

Clinical and microbiological effects of subgingival delivery of 10% minocycline-loaded (MC), bioabsorbable microcapsules were examined in 15 adult periodontitis patients. Patients received oral hygiene instruction 2 weeks prior to the study. At baseline (day 0) all teeth received supragingival scaling (SC); 2 quadrants received no further treatment and 1 quadrant received subgingival scaling and root planning (SRP). In the fourth quadrant, the tooth with the deepest probing sites (at least 1 site > or = 5 mm) was treated with minocycline microcapsules. The sites were evaluated at baseline and weeks 1, 2, 4, and 6. Clinical indices included bleeding on probing (BOP), probing depths (PD), and attachment loss (AL). Microbiological evaluations included percent morphotypes by phase-contrast microscopy; cultivable anaerobic, aerobic, and black-pigmented Bacteroides (BPB); and percent Porphyromonas gingivalis, Prevotella intermedia, Eikenella corrodens, and Actinomyces viscosus by indirect immunofluorescence. In the SC + MC group, BOP, PD, and AL were significantly reduced from baseline for weeks 1 to 6. BOP in the SC + MC group was significantly reduced compared to the SRP group from weeks 2 to 6. In the SC + MC group the percent of spirochetes and motile rods decreased and the percent of cocci increased after 1 week. The increased cocci and decreased motile rods were statistically greater at weeks 4 and 6 in the SC + MC group compared to the SRP group. This study demonstrates that local subgingival delivery of 10% minocycline-loaded microcapsules as an adjunct to scaling results in reduction in the percent sites bleeding on probing greater than scaling and root planning alone and induces a microbial response more favorable for periodontal health than scaling and root planing.  相似文献

A systematic evaluation of the ability of different bacterial genera to transform 2,4,6-trinitrotoluene (TNT), and grow in its presence, was conducted. Aerobic Gram-negative organisms degraded TNT and evidenced net consumption of reduced metabolites when cultured in molasses medium. Some Gram-negative isolates transformed all the initial TNT to undetectable metabolites, with no adsorption of TNT or metabolites to cells. Growth and TNT transformation capacity of Gram-positive bacteria both exhibited 50% reductions in the presence of approximately 10 microg TNT ml-1. Most non-sporeforming Gram-positive organisms incubated in molasses media amended with 80 microg TNT ml-1 became unculturable, whereas all strains tested remained culturable when incubated in mineral media amended with 98 microg TNT ml-1, indicating that TNT sensitivity is linked to metabolic activity. These results indicate that the microbial ecology of soil may be severely impacted by TNT contamination.  相似文献

The aim of the current study was to identify genetic abnormalities in human colorectal adenoma and carcinoma derived cell lines, and to determine whether the genetic changes which occur in vitro are relevant to the in vivo situation. Loss of 1p(33-35) region was shown to be the most common chromosome 1 abnormality and loss of heterozygosity (LOH) of the DCC gene and/or adjacent sequences was detected in all adenoma derived cells as well as the carcinoma cell lines. The level of p53 protein was also investigated as increased cellular p53 protein had previously been associated with mutation of the p53 gene. A further aim was to investigate genetic changes in our in vitro model of tumour progression, where the adenoma derived PC/AA cell line has previously been converted in vitro to two distinct tumorigenic phenotypes, producing either an adenocarcinoma or a mucinous carcinoma in athymic nude mice. Progression to the adenocarcinoma phenotype was shown to involve a specific chromosome 1 rearrangement, loss of both normal copies of chromosome 18 (although DCC gene sequences were retained), loss of the remaining wild type allele of k-ras resulting in homozygosity for the k-ras codon 12 mutation and increased cellular p53 protein as detected by SDS-PAGE Western blotting. The increase in p53 protein was shown not to be due to the acquisition of a mutation in the p53 gene. Interestingly, progression of the adenoma derived PC/AA cell line to the mucinous malignant phenotype did not involve any of these molecular rearrangements, suggesting that different genetically distinct pathways are involved in colorectal carcinogenesis. These studies show that the genetic changes in our in vitro model of human colorectal tumour progression are similar to those observed in in vivo studies.  相似文献

The area under the liver was dissected in 27 human autopsy specimens to search for lymph nodes in the fissures. Nodes were present in all instances. They were in the transverse fissure, posterior to the portal vein, posterior to pars transversus of the left portal vein and associated with the left hepatic artery. The size varied from 2 millimeters to 2 centimeters. Each node was histologically confirmed. Nodes were infrequent and small on the right. Nodes were not found between the portal vein, hepatic artery and bile ducts in the fissures. Nodes were found outside the fissures in the fascia between the bile duct and hepatic artery. Occlusion of the portal vein and hepatic artery could be expected before occlusion of the bile duct. Node enlargement in the transverse fissure is anticipated as a rare cause of jaundice.  相似文献

Results of field feeding preference studies with 12 species of tropical green algae of the genusCaulerpa showed thatC. ashmeadii was preferred least by herbivorous fishes. Chemical investigations ofC. ashmeadii demonstrated the presence of high concentrations of sesquiterpenoid metabolites. The chemical isolation and structural elucidation of five majorC. ashmeadii metabolites, as well as the results of field feeding preference, antimicrobial, and ichthyotoxicity assays demonstrating the biological activities of these metabolites are reported here.  相似文献

Twenty-eight genetic loci have been physically mapped to specific large restriction fragments of the Streptococcus mutans GS-5 chromosome by hybridization with probes of cloned genes or, for transposon-generated amino acid auxotrophs, with probes for Tn916. In addition, restriction fragments generated by one low-frequency-cleavage enzyme were used as probes to identify overlapping fragments generated by other restriction enzymes. The approach allowed construction of a low resolution physical map of the S. mutans GS-5 genome using restriction enzymes ApaI (5'-GGGCC/C), SmaI (5'-CCC/GGG), and NotI (5'-GC/GGCCGC).  相似文献
